Skip to content

Instantly share code, notes, and snippets.

Monkey Do MonkeyDo

Block or report user

Report or block MonkeyDo

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
View BB API GSOC 2019
Auth
- No need for an application page, we will use MetaBrainz’ (currently on MusicBrainz website (https://musicbrainz.org/account/applications).
- No need to generate or store tokens, only handling auth with existing token for existing user. No need to add a DB table to store tokens.
- Possibly a UI change will be needed with a shortcut or simple page that redirects to MBs applications page
Tech stack
- Any good reason why we should use Koa over Express, considering we already use Express for the web server and can possibly reuse some code? https://github.com/koajs/koa/blob/master/docs/koa-vs-express.md
- I don’t think we need Kong. The auth and rate-limiting can be done in Express with the help of packages (links below). Kong will introduce extra requests = extra latency
- Caching with Redis can also be done with Express (links below)
View react-select optionComponent
/*
* Copyright (C) 2015-2017 Ben Ockmore
* 2015-2016 Sean Burke
*
* This program is free software; you can redistribute it and/or modify
* it under the terms of the GNU General Public License as published by
* the Free Software Foundation; either version 2 of the License, or
* (at your option) any later version.
*
* This program is distributed in the hope that it will be useful,
View missing works
<div>
<h2>Works</h2>
{
entity.works.length ?
<React.Fragment>
<Table striped>
<thead>
<tr>
<th>Name</th>
<th>Type</th>
View node-red-contrib-modbus 6 PLCs
[
{
"id": "c221d6dd.a94f88",
"type": "tab",
"label": "Flow 4"
},
{
"id": "57a8686a.357858",
"type": "modbus-flex-getter",
"z": "c221d6dd.a94f88",
@MonkeyDo
MonkeyDo / links.less
Last active May 17, 2017
Bootstrap 3 less file for styling :visited links
View links.less
You can’t perform that action at this time.